举例场景一:部署边界网络监控【需要在互联网/广域网出口部署IDS/分析软件等】场景一的传统解决方案1:端口镜像/SPANSPAN解决方案的问题:–流量不能超过端口速率的50%;–无法灵活选择需要监控分析的链路,大多路由器没有SPAN功能;–不能保证原始数据包顺序;–交换机负载高时会丢包;–某些故障数据包不能通过镜像获得;–无法分辨进出方向;场景一的传统解决方案2:串接HubHub解决方案的问题:产
分类:
其他好文 时间:
2020-02-29 00:52:25
阅读次数:
59
我们平常经常说UDP是不可靠连接,TCP是可靠连接,然而TCP为什么是可靠的呢 1. TCP和UDP的优缺点TCP 缺点: [1] 三次握手四次挥手,传输更多包,浪费一些带宽[2] 为了进行可靠通信,双方都要维持在线,通信过程中服务器server可能出现非常大的并发连接,浪费了系统资源,甚至会出现宕 ...
分类:
其他好文 时间:
2020-02-28 18:36:57
阅读次数:
130
RPC: 远程过程调用,像调用本地服务(方法)一样调用服务器的服务 支持同步、异步调用 客户端和服务器之间建立TCP连接,可以一次建立一个,也可以多个调用复用一次链接 PRC数据包小 protobuf thrift rpc:编解码,序列化,链接,丢包,协议 Rest(Http): http请求,支持 ...
分类:
其他好文 时间:
2020-02-28 01:27:11
阅读次数:
52
1.TCP和UDP的区别 === (1)TCP是面向连接的协议,UDP是面向无连接的协议。 (2)TCP对系统资源要求较多,UDP对系统资源要求较少。 (3)TCP是数据流模式,UDP是数据报模式。 (4)TCP保证数据顺序及数据的正确性,UDP可能会丢包。 2.简述TCP/UDP服务器端创建流程与 ...
分类:
其他好文 时间:
2020-02-25 16:10:39
阅读次数:
84
LBDP-Z可支持STM32通过无线模块实现在线升级,FCm = 0x41/0x51仅支持广播模式(取消单播升级模式)。 因广播模式可能发生丢包,因此需要多次发送,在代码校验后进行升级操作。增加FCn=0x39命令: FCn=0x39: 校验flash、设置升级标志并复位,后跟6字数据,开始地址(2 ...
分类:
其他好文 时间:
2020-02-22 11:44:56
阅读次数:
54
一、TCP是面向连接的,需要先建立连接(三次握手和四次挥手)再发送数据。UDP是无连接的,不需要建立连接。 二、TCP是可靠的,如果丢包会进行重传,并且数据包是有序的。UDP是不可靠的,如果数据包丢失,不会进行重传,并且,UDP传输的数据包是乱序的。 三、TCP会进行流量控制和拥塞控制,UDP只会不 ...
分类:
其他好文 时间:
2020-02-20 19:54:41
阅读次数:
60
磁盘IO和网络IO该如何评估、监控、性能定位和优化生产中经常遇到一些IO延时长导致的系统吞吐量下降、响应时间慢等问题,例如交换机故障、网线老化导致的丢包重传;存储阵列条带宽度不足、缓存不足、QoS限制、RAID级别设置不当等引起的IO延时。一、评估IO能力的前提评估一个系统IO能力的前提是需要搞清楚这个系统的IO模型是怎么样的。那么IO模型是什么,为什么要提炼IO模型呢?(一)、IO模型在实际的业
分类:
其他好文 时间:
2020-02-17 13:57:08
阅读次数:
76
dropwatch使用前提: 1、首先内核必须大于等于2.6.30; 2、编译内核时应该加上“NET_DROP_MONITOR=y”; ...
分类:
其他好文 时间:
2020-02-09 16:20:31
阅读次数:
94
OSI参考模型 与 TCP/IP模型 应用层 - > 应用层 表示层 会话层 传输层 -> 传输层 数据链路层 -> 网络接口层 物理层 一般主要考察TCP/IP,因为TCP/IP才是常用的,OSI只是理想上 各层设备及传输单位 物理层:中继器 集线器 单位:bit流 数据链路层:网桥 交换机 网卡 ...
分类:
其他好文 时间:
2020-02-05 10:00:57
阅读次数:
87
netstat-打印网络连接,路由表,接口统计信息的工具,在平常工作也会经常遇到; 常用选项: -i:查看网卡数据包收发情况(常用于查看是否有丢包、错误) -s:对各种协议的统计信息 -r:查看路由表信息(也常用route -n)查看 用法示例一:查看网络包收发情况,以确定是否存在丢包的情况(当网络 ...
分类:
Web程序 时间:
2020-02-01 12:35:02
阅读次数:
144